The International Wildlife Coalition Trust, IWCT, was founded in 1992 to promote
Whale and Elephant conservation. In 1998, we learnt about the unspeakable
cruelty and brutality of the dog meat trade in the Philippines and as a result
we began a campaign to tackle the appalling trading and slaughter of dogs for
meat. IWCT has now been working in the Philippines for nearly 25 years. A
fundamental part of our efforts in the early years was working with government
and law enforcement to bring an end to the barbaric dog meat trade in the
Philippines and we played a crucial role in pushing through animal welfare
legislation which now means it is illegal to slaughter dogs for human
consumption in the Philippines.
